Hi,

We are having problems on multiple Macs with installing and opening After Effects.

The Error appearing is;

The Common Extensibility Platform (CEP) suite couldn't be loaded. You may need to Reinstall.

After Effects will only work when we log out of our user profile and log in as admin. I have change permissions on the Application files by Right-clicking and showing more info and changing the permissions for everyone to Read and Write. But the error does not disappear.

Does anyone know a solution to resolve this error?

    Upon getting this same error message, instead of choosing to migrate settings. I chose to not migrate the old settings and it loaded right on up.

    Try deleting Ae's preferences so that everything starts from scratch.

    - Close Ae.

    - When clic to open Ae, immediately press Shft + Alt + Cmd and keep pressing these three keys until If you see a dialog box where you are asked if you want to delete the preferences, press OK.
